App快速开发平台是一种帮助开发者快速构建移动应用程序的工具或服务。以下是一些常见的App快速开发平台类型:
1. 原生开发平台:
- Appcelerator:这是一个由IBM开发的跨平台应用程序开发框架,它允许开发者使用JavaScript和HTML5编写原生代码,并利用模拟器进行调试。
- React Native:这是一个基于React.js的跨平台应用程序开发框架,它可以将React组件转换为原生代码,并利用模拟器进行调试。
2. 跨平台开发框架:
- Flutter:这是一个由Google开发的跨平台移动应用程序开发框架,它使用Dart语言编写,并提供了丰富的UI组件和工具。
- Ionic:这是一个由PhoneGap推出的跨平台移动应用程序开发框架,它使用HTML5、CSS3和JavaScript编写,并提供了丰富的UI组件和工具。
3. 云原生开发平台:
- Firebase:这是一个由Google提供的实时数据分析平台,它提供了实时数据处理、存储和分析的功能,可以帮助开发者快速构建移动应用程序。
- Amazon Web Services(AWS)云开发:AWS Cloud Development Kit是一个用于创建和部署移动应用程序的SDK,它提供了丰富的API和工具,可以帮助开发者快速构建移动应用程序。
4. 开源开发平台:
- PhoneGap:这是一个由PhoneGap推出的跨平台移动应用程序开发框架,它使用HTML5、CSS3和JavaScript编写,并提供了丰富的UI组件和工具。
- React Native Packager:这是一个用于打包React Native应用程序的工具,它提供了预编译的APK文件,可以在不同的设备上运行。
5. 社区驱动的开发平台:
- Xamarin:这是一个由Microsoft推出的跨平台移动应用程序开发框架,它使用C#语言编写,并提供了丰富的UI组件和工具。
- Electron:这是一个由GitHub推出的跨平台桌面应用程序开发框架,它使用Node.js和浏览器技术编写,并提供了丰富的UI组件和工具。
这些App快速开发平台为开发者提供了不同的选择,可以根据项目需求、团队技能和资源等因素选择合适的平台。